Phuket’s allure as a beach paradise is undeniable, and if you’re arriving by cruise ship, you’re likely docking at the Phuket Deep Sea Port. But how do you get from the port to the vibrant Patong Beach? Don’t worry, this blog post will guide you through your transfer options.

Understanding the Docking Situation:

Phuket actually has two main docking locations for cruise ships. During peak season (roughly November to April), you might dock closer to Patong Beach itself, eliminating the need for an extensive transfer. However, in the monsoon season (May to October), you’ll likely arrive at the Phuket Deep Sea Port, located further south in Ao Makham.

Transfer Options from Phuket Deep Sea Port:

  • Taxis: Taxis are a readily available option at the port. While convenient, fares can be higher, especially if you don’t negotiate beforehand. Agree on a price before getting in to avoid surprises.

  • Shared Vans: A more budget-friendly option is a shared van. These vans operate on a set schedule with pre-determined drop-off locations. While they might take a bit longer due to multiple stops, they’re a good choice for cost-conscious travelers.

  • Pre-Booked Transfers: Consider booking a private transfer service in advance. This offers more flexibility and comfort, especially if you’re traveling with a group or have specific luggage requirements.

How Long Does it Take?

The distance from Phuket Deep Sea Port to Patong Beach is roughly 50 kilometers. Depending on traffic conditions, a taxi ride can take around 45 minutes to an hour. Shared vans might take slightly longer due to additional stops.

Additional Tips:

  • Cash is King: While some vendors might accept cards, it’s always good to have Thai Baht handy for taxis or any other incidental expenses.

  • Estimated Taxi Fares: Expect taxi fares to start around 300 THB (roughly $8 USD) and can go higher depending on negotiation and traffic.
